This series consists of photographs, a 16 mm motion picture film strip, and an audio recording related to Ron Nessen’s role as Press Secretary to President Gerald R. Ford. The film strip contains footage of President Ford appointing Nessen as Press Secretary. The audio cassette contains a recording of Nessen speaking before the National Press Club. A few photographs relate to Nessen’s personal life, including a trip to Mackinac Island and a picture of Andrew Sherling, a high school classmate. Most of the photographs are official White House photographs, including pictures released to the press in Europe prior to President Ford’s visit and images of Ford’s first year in office.
Collection: Ron Nessen Papers

This series consists of audio recordings of interviews with former President Gerald R. Ford, Ford White House staff, agency officials, and congressmen. The interviews focus heavily on Gerald Ford’s response to the economic and energy crises of the 1970s, inflation, relations with Congress, 1975 State of the Union Address, and the 1976 Presidential campaign.
Other areas of discussion include: Ford’s public image, the speech writing process, accessibility to Ford by White House staff and Members of Congress, the Office of Management and Budget, and the President’s veto record. A number of individuals feature prominently in the dialogues, including: Ronald Reagan, George H.W. Bush, Richard Nixon, Bob Dole, Nelson Rockefeller, Donald Rumsfeld, Alan Greenspan, Arthur Burns, William Simon, Frank Zarb, and Robert Hartmann.
Collection: Yanek Mieczkowski Research Interviews
